什么叫数据库和系统的关系

worktile 其他 5

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库和系统之间存在着密切的关系。数据库是系统中存储和管理数据的核心组件,而系统则是包含了数据库以及其他相关组件的整体架构。

    1. 数据库是系统的基础组件之一:数据库是系统中用于存储和管理数据的软件,它提供了一种结构化的方式来组织和存储数据。系统中的其他组件,如用户界面、应用程序等,都需要通过数据库来访问和处理数据。

    2. 数据库支持系统的数据需求:系统在运行过程中会产生大量的数据,这些数据需要被存储、检索和处理。数据库提供了高效的数据存储和检索机制,可以满足系统对数据的各种需求,如数据的增删改查、数据的统计和分析等。

    3. 数据库提供数据一致性和完整性:系统中的数据往往是相互关联的,数据库可以通过定义数据之间的关系和约束来确保数据的一致性和完整性。例如,可以定义外键约束来保证数据的引用完整性,可以定义唯一约束来保证数据的唯一性等。

    4. 数据库支持系统的并发操作:在一个系统中,可能会有多个用户同时访问和修改数据,数据库可以提供并发控制机制,确保多个用户之间的操作不会相互干扰。例如,数据库可以使用锁机制来控制对数据的并发访问,以避免数据的冲突和不一致。

    5. 数据库提供系统的数据备份和恢复:系统中的数据可能会因为各种原因而丢失或损坏,数据库可以提供数据备份和恢复的机制,确保数据的安全性和可靠性。通过定期备份数据库,可以在数据丢失或损坏时快速恢复系统的正常运行。

    综上所述,数据库是系统中不可或缺的组件,它为系统提供了数据的存储、管理、检索和处理功能,保证了系统的数据一致性、完整性和安全性,支持了系统的并发操作和数据备份恢复。数据库和系统之间的关系密不可分,相互依存,共同构成了一个完整的信息管理系统。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库和系统是密不可分的,它们之间存在着紧密的关系。数据库是系统中存储数据的集合,而系统则是利用这些数据进行各种操作和处理的工具。

    首先,数据库是系统的核心组成部分之一。系统中的各种数据,如用户信息、产品信息、订单信息等都需要被存储起来,以便系统能够对这些数据进行处理和管理。数据库提供了一个结构化的方式来组织和存储这些数据,使得系统能够高效地访问和操作这些数据。

    其次,系统通过数据库来实现数据的持久化存储。系统中的数据往往需要长期保存,以便后续使用和分析。数据库能够将数据以文件的形式保存在磁盘上,即使系统关闭或重启,数据仍然能够被保留下来。这样,系统可以随时从数据库中读取数据,而不需要每次启动都重新生成数据。

    此外,系统通过数据库来实现数据的共享和共享。在一个组织或企业中,不同的系统可能需要共享同一份数据,以便实现数据的一致性和统一性。数据库提供了一个中央存储的地方,各个系统可以通过访问数据库来获取和更新数据,确保数据的一致性和可靠性。

    最后,系统通过数据库来实现数据的安全性和完整性。数据库可以对数据进行权限控制,只有具有相应权限的用户才能访问和修改数据。此外,数据库还可以通过事务处理来确保数据的完整性,即在数据的插入、更新或删除操作中,要么全部成功,要么全部失败,保证数据的一致性和可靠性。

    综上所述,数据库和系统之间存在着紧密的关系。数据库是系统中存储数据的核心组成部分,通过数据库系统能够实现数据的持久化存储、共享和共享、安全性和完整性保证。数据库和系统的关系互为依存,相辅相成,共同构成了一个完整的信息管理系统。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库和系统之间存在着紧密的关系。数据库是系统的一个组成部分,用于存储、管理和处理系统中的数据。系统可以是一个软件系统,也可以是一个硬件系统。

    数据库的作用是提供一个结构化的数据存储和管理环境,使系统能够高效地访问和处理数据。系统可以通过数据库来存储和检索数据,从而实现各种业务功能。

    数据库和系统之间的关系可以从以下几个方面来理解:

    1. 数据共享:数据库可以为系统提供一个集中存储数据的地方,不同的系统可以通过访问数据库来共享数据。这样可以避免数据的冗余和不一致,并且提高数据的安全性和可靠性。

    2. 数据一致性:系统中的不同模块可能需要共享同一数据,如果每个模块都维护自己的数据副本,容易导致数据的不一致。而使用数据库可以统一管理数据,保证数据的一致性。

    3. 数据安全:数据库可以提供各种安全机制,如用户认证、权限管理、数据加密等,保护系统中的数据不被非法访问和篡改。

    4. 数据处理:数据库提供了丰富的数据处理功能,如查询、排序、统计、备份、恢复等,可以帮助系统高效地处理大量的数据。

    5. 性能优化:数据库管理系统通常具有优化查询和存储的能力,可以通过索引、分区、缓存等技术提高系统的性能。

    数据库和系统之间的关系可以通过以下操作流程来说明:

    1. 数据库设计:在系统开发的初期,需要进行数据库设计,确定系统所需的数据表、字段、关系等。数据库设计要考虑系统的需求、数据的结构和业务逻辑,以及性能和安全等因素。

    2. 数据库创建:在数据库设计完成后,需要在系统中创建数据库。这包括创建数据库实例、表空间、用户、角色等。数据库创建要考虑数据库管理系统的要求和系统的运行环境。

    3. 数据库连接:系统需要与数据库建立连接,以便能够访问和操作数据库。连接可以通过数据库连接字符串、驱动程序等方式进行配置。连接还需要进行身份验证,确保只有授权的用户可以访问数据库。

    4. 数据操作:系统可以通过数据库提供的接口和语言(如SQL)来对数据库进行操作。这包括插入、更新、删除和查询数据等操作。数据操作可以通过事务来进行管理,确保数据的一致性和完整性。

    5. 数据管理:系统需要对数据库中的数据进行管理,包括备份、恢复、性能优化、监控等。这些管理操作可以通过数据库管理系统的工具和命令来完成。

    总之,数据库是系统的重要组成部分,负责存储和管理系统中的数据。系统通过数据库来共享数据、保证数据的一致性和安全性,以及实现各种数据处理和管理功能。数据库和系统之间的关系是密切的,相互依赖、相互支持。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部